A bonus room is generally built in the attic, often over the garage, in a house that has a steep roof pitch to allow for living space to be built. A guest suite is generally added to the first floor of a home and requires additional foundation and exterior walls making it a more expensive option.
Can you build a bathroom over a garage?
Yes, you can build a bathroom above an unheated garage‚ say Brewster and Tiplady. But pipes need to stay in areas that are heated, and they can’t go in exterior walls.
How much does it cost to build an apartment over a garage?
Building an apartment above a garage costs $110 to $350 per square foot or $60,000 to $270,000. Pricing depends on whether you add a simple loft room in over a single-car unit or a full apartment over a four-stall structure.

What is an apartment above a garage called?
A garage apartment is an apartment built within the walls of, or on top of, the garage of a house. A garage apartment is one type of “accessory dwelling unit” or ADU, a term used by architects, urban planners and in zoning ordinances to identify apartments smaller than the main dwelling on one lot or parcel of land.
Do you need planning permission to turn a garage into a room?
Planning permission is not usually required to convert your garage into additional living space for your home, providing the work is internal and does not involve enlarging the building. A condition attached to a planning permission may also require that the garage remain as a parking space.

Can my garage support a second story?
Most attached garages are constructed with a framed or block wall, both of which are strong enough to support a second-story room above them. If it will support the room, it actually is easier to add the new room to a detached garage because you have four exterior walls with which to work.
